Difference between firm and industry?

a firm is a business unit that operates under a single management. while industry is a group of firm that produce similar products for the same market.

What is the difference between a market maker and a market taker in the financial industry?

A market maker is a trader who provides liquidity by buying and selling securities, while a market taker is a trader who accepts the prices offered by market makers and executes trades based on those prices.


What is the difference between consumer and industrial marketing?

In a consumer market the consumer uses the product for personal use but in an industrial market the industry uses the products as supplys or/ and to do operations
